Prince Harry + Duchess Meghan: Strong criticism of unloading state reception

This measure could harden the fronts between the royal family and the Sussexes: Prince Harry and Duchess Meghan are said to have been unloaded from the state reception the day before Queen Elizabeth’s funeral. “Totally crazy,” says a friend of the couple.

It would be a further humiliation for Prince Harry, 38, and Duchess Meghan, 41, during their mourning stay in Great Britain: The couple is said to have received an invitation to the state reception for crowned heads and heads of government on Sunday, September 18, 2022, at Buckingham Palace last week have received. But the Sussexes are said to have been unloaded at short notice. Palace officials allegedly gave the reason that they, as non-working royals, should not appear at the high-profile event hosted by King Charles III, 73, and Queen Camilla, 75. A step that is viewed critically by the couple’s circle of friends.

Prince Harry and Duchess Meghan: “Excluded” and injured?

The world mourns Queen Elizabeth, † 96. On September 19, 20222 the monarch of the century will be laid to rest. On the eve of the great state funeral, King Charles and his wife received around 1,000 high-ranking guests, including various heads of state, ambassadors and foreign royals. Members of the royal family stood by the newly proclaimed monarch as a welcoming committee: Prince William, 40, Catherine, Princess of Wales, 40, Princess Anne, 72, with her husband Sir Tim Laurence, 67, Prince Edward, 58, and Countess Sophie of Wessex, 57.

However, Prince Harry and Duchess Meghan were absent, although they are said to have previously received an invitation to the reception. Rumors about the Queen’s grandson and his wife being unloaded were already circulating in advance. The palace’s decision to rule out the two at short notice was met with harsh criticism. A friend of the Sussexes told The Sunday Times, “It’s absolutely crazy when they’re not there. Everyone comes from all over the world to pay their respects to the Queen.”

The confidant, who is said to be close to the couple, pointed out that Harry and Meghan may feel “left out” after the invitation was allegedly withdrawn.



A development that could put further obstacles in the way of a rapprochement between the couple, who retired as senior royals in 2020, and the royal family. The past two weeks revealed old and created new deep injuries on both sides.

humiliations in times of mourning

When the two royals, who live in the United States, set foot together again on European soil for several events in early September and visited Great Britain and Germany, there was no official indication of a meeting with family members. The two had allegedly not even planned a visit to the frail-looking Queen.

When news of her worrisome health condition broke on September 8th and her next of kin rushed to her, Harry was the last to travel to her deathbed. It was later said the delay in his arrival may have been related to discussions about whether Meghan would be allowed to accompany him to Balmoral. It was said to have been the wish of the 41-year-old. When Charles’ youngest son made his way from London to Scotland alone, rumors spread.

Initially, the change of plan was attributed to Catherine, who also did not accompany her husband to Aberdeenshire in order to gently teach her children the bereavement that was already becoming apparent at this point. In addition, palace officials are said to have reacted to Meghan’s concerns with raised eyebrows, since the relationship between the Sussexes and the royal relatives has been disturbed by their open-hearted and public criticism of the royal family in the past two years. A few days later it was said that King Charles himself had asked Harry not to bring his wife.

The royal family’s time of mourning and public appearances promised further humiliation for the Duke of Sussex: With his retirement from the front ranks of the royal family, the former military forfeited any right to wear uniform at state events.
